I’m quite new to the world of illustration and am improving all the time but one things I’ve always been timid with is lighting and shading. It takes me much longer than it should to build up tonal depth because I’m always afraid to add the dark shadows and bright highlights… and my illustrations suffer because of it. I’m slowly overcoming it, however. This is a quick example that shows how I saved a muddy and flat illustration by refining my lighting.
